serum leptin level is reduced in non-obese subjects with type 2 diabetes

background leptin, a protein released from adipose tissue, could have significant role in pathogenesis of obesity and type 2 diabetes mellitus. conclusions it is speculated that lower serum leptin levels in diabetic patients may be a consequence of male gender. moreover, results suggest that serum leptin level in women is influenced differently than that in men. results the serum leptin level in type 2 diabetic patients (19.32 ± 11.43 ng/ml) was significantly lower than that in non-diabetic subjects (32.16 ± 11.02 ng/ml). serum leptin level was strongly and positively correlated with body mass index (bmi) (r = 0.658, p < 0.0001) and calculated body fat percentage (r = 0.431, p < 0.0001) in all the study subjects with a better corrlation in the control subjcts compared to control cases (r = 0.661 for bmi and r = 0.466 for body fat). on the other hand, leptin showed a positive and significant correlation with insulin and homa- β (homeostasis model assessment for β-cell function) in both groups. furthermore, leptin related to homeostasis model assessment for insulin resistance (homa-ir) (r = 0.422, p = 0.006) was observed only in t2dm subjects. leptin showed negative correlation with waist to hip ratio in diabetic (r = -0.407, p =0.008) and non-diabetic subjects (r = -0.318, p =0.049). in the regression model, bmi, homa-β, and gender were independent predictors of leptin in all subjects. however, in non-diabetic and diabetic subjects, β-cell function and insulin were independent predictors, respectively (p =0.01). objectives this study aimed to evaluate variations in serum leptin levels in non-obese subjects with type 2 diabetes mellitus (t2dm). patients and methods we studied forty-one patients with type 2 diabetes. fasting lipid profile, hemoglobin a1c (hba1c), serum leptin, insulin, and glucose levels were measured by standard methods.
